Perilsome

adj

adj ·Rare ·Advanced level

Definitions

Adjective
  1. 1
    Characterised or marked by peril; perilous

    "In which regard it was considered of by the common table of the cupbearers what a perilsome thing it was to let any stranger or out-dweller approach so near the precincts of the prince as the great chamber without examining what he was and giving him his pass."

Etymology

From peril + -some.
